Jerry Jones has much to ponder in the next coming weeks as the Dallas Cowboys have three cornerstone players requiring new contracts, but one expert believes they should take a gamble on their quarterback.

America’s Team has backed itself into a corner because of its delayed approach when settling extensions with their biggest hits to the salary cap.

The Dallas Cowboys are entering contract years for their star wide receiver CeeDee Lamb and veteran Dak Prescott.

Lamb has shown his cards as he persists with a holdout to leverage a new deal

Lamb has been absent from the franchise’s mandatory minicamp, which demonstrates he is not entering through the franchise’s doors before getting a new contract.

Defensive edge Micah Parsons is one year behind his teammate’s timeline but is eligible for a new deal.

Moreover, the 24-year-old is set to become the highest-paid defensive star and overtake Nick Bosa’s enormous deal when the time comes.

Yet, their quarterback remains unsure if he is set to play on a contract year.

The Dallas Cowboys have not engaged in any talks with their largest cap hit of 2024, as he is set to cost the franchise $55.4 million.

Jerry Jones has missed the sensible window to extend Dak Prescott

If Jerry Jones were to extend the 2023 MVP runner-up, the sensible time would have been before free agency had commenced.

The franchise could have been able to restructure his contract and open up vital cap space to sign the players they need to reach an NFC Championship.

Nonetheless, the front office was not interested in that solution and now must decide how to spend their money.

The Cowboys could risk letting their signal-caller hit the open market as an unrestricted free agent.

Furthermore, talks of Prescott blowing the QB market through the roof and earning the first $60 million APY have been uttered.

NFL expert suggests the franchise should risk losing Prescott to free agency

FS1 expert Nick Wright believes the franchise should take a punt on losing Prescott and sign Lamb and Parsons now.

“I think obviously you re-sign Micah Parsons, he is one of the five best defensive players in the sport. Obviously, you re-sign CeeDee Lamb he is one of the five best receivers in the sport,” Wright said on The Herd podcast

“They are both in their early to mid-twenties, you drafted them with first-round picks. They have exceeded expectations. I’m fine with the Cowboys rolling the dice on losing Dak Prescott a year from now.”

Preseason is swiftly approaching and the summer break is upon us imminently, so, it would be wise they lock in CeeDee Lamb to not delay the process any longer.

Furthermore, the golden moment to extend Prescott has now passed and the franchise may make him earn his mega contract through postseason success.

NFL Insider Tom Pelissero has stated the coaching staff wants the Louisana native to be the long-term future.

However, Mike McCarthy is entering a contract year, therefore, his wishes may be irrelevant this time next year.
